Detoxification is the first part of quitting drugs and alcohol, and you might choose to go through detoxification in a hospital inpatient detoxification facility for several reasons. Hospital inpatient detoxification in Roe offers medically managed detox services, which is carried out with the assistance of nurses and physicians who can make detoxification more comfortable, using medications to alleviate withdrawal symptoms and even make detox safer. An individual detoxing from alcohol for example may need specific medications during detox to prevent seizures and tremors that commonly occur during severe alcohol withdrawal. A person who is suffering with heroin or prescription opioid withdrawal may choose to undergo medical detoxification in a hospital inpatient facility, where medications are utilized to help them through a very uncomfortable (but typically not life threatening) type of withdrawal. People in a hospital inpatient detoxification facility remain at the facility until the withdrawal symptoms have gone away. This could be anywhere from 5 days to 2 weeks depending on what drug they are withdrawing from and their overall physical and mental health.

For a person who has been struggling with substance abuse issues for some time, there would ideally be an immediate and smooth transition from a hospital inpatient detoxification facility to a drug rehab center to treat their addiction given that detox is not treatment in itself.
